This is how I managed to fix the problem...and I hope this helps others in the similar situation.
I tried with another program..latest version of Nero, and this was also stopping at the 'initialising' stage. I was now lost! I thought the last resort is to give Evesham (My PC manufacturer) a buzz. They were very helpfull. Basically go into 'Control Panel', 'System', and click on the Hardware tab, then 'Device Manager'. Uninstall everything in the DVD/CDRom Drives. Then uninstall everything under the catagory IDE ATA/Atapi disk controllers. This is where my problem was, as I only had one IDE channel here. You should have 4 or 5! Reboot your machine, and everything will automatically re-load. I tried burning using Nero and it worked. Then the big test was iTunes. It worked 1st time!
I asked why the IDE channels have dissappearred, and he said sometimes uninstalling Programmes occasionally removes them.
I hope this will help others who are having problems to burn stuff on iTunes. I can give more info if you need it.
